The solar buying journey typically starts with the financial question "does this make sense for my home?" not with the installer question. Homeowners search for federal tax credit amounts, state rebate programs, net metering policies, and utility buyback rates weeks before they search for a local solar company.
If your website has dedicated content for those research-phase searches ("solar tax credit [state]," "net metering [utility]," "solar rebate program [city]") you appear throughout the entire research window, not just at the end of it. Homeowners who find you during their financial research arrive at the quote stage already familiar with your company and already trusting your knowledge of the local incentive landscape.
This is one of the most consistently underleveraged SEO opportunities in the residential solar market. Most installers have no incentive content on their websites. Building it creates a significant competitive advantage in both search rankings and conversion rates.

Why Most Solar Company Websites Don't Rank on Google.
No Local Service Area Content
A generic homepage saying "we serve the greater Phoenix area" ranks for almost nothing specific. Homeowners search for solar installers in their city and suburb, not in a regional area. Dedicated location pages for every community you serve are among the fastest-ranking content types in the solar category and generate consistently qualified local leads.
Missing Incentive and Research Content
Most solar websites have service pages but no content targeting the research phase. Homeowners searching for ITC tax credits, net metering policies, and state rebate programs are weeks away from requesting a quote, and they are building a shortlist of trusted companies throughout that research. If your website does not appear during those searches, you are not on the shortlist.
Underoptimized Google Business Profile
Your GBP is where homeowners validate your credibility before they call. Most solar companies have a claimed profile with incomplete service descriptions, few photos, and reviews that stopped accumulating months ago. The companies with the strongest Map Pack positions treat their GBP as an active weekly asset; regular posts, fresh photos of completed installations, and consistent review velocity.
No Battery Storage Content
Battery backup is one of the fastest-growing search categories in residential solar. Homeowners concerned about grid outages, those in areas with time-of-use utility pricing, and those looking to maximize their solar ROI are all actively searching for battery storage options. If your website has no content targeting battery backup searches, you are invisible for one of the highest-growth segments in your market.
National Installer Competition
National solar brands (Sunrun, SunPower, Tesla Solar) have massive content budgets and rank well for broad terms. Local installers consistently outperform them for location-specific searches because national brands cannot build hyper-local content at scale. Your advantage is local specificity. Location pages, local incentive content, and local GBP dominance consistently outperform national competitors at the city and suburb level.
No Commercial Solar Content
Commercial solar (warehouses, office buildings, retail properties, agricultural facilities) represents significantly larger installations and often more straightforward project economics than residential. If your website has no content targeting commercial clients, you are invisible for the searches that can represent your single highest-value contracts.
